The TRANSITION NETWORKS S3290-42-AR is a Network Interface Device (NID) configured as an AR bundle, providing four twisted-pair (TP) copper ports and two SFP fiber slots in a single unit. Designed for enterprise and carrier-edge deployments, this NID serves as a demarcation point between service provider infrastructure and customer premises equipment. It is typically installed by network technicians and field engineers working on Ethernet access, last-mile connectivity, or managed service delivery projects where both copper and fiber handoff options are required.
The S3290-42-AR suits enterprise network environments where mixed-media connectivity is needed at the network edge. Its combination of TP and SFP interfaces makes it adaptable for both local copper runs and fiber uplinks in the same chassis. This unit is sold as an EA (each) and is categorized as an Enterprise PoE device, indicating suitability for deployments where Power over Ethernet capability at the edge is part of the network design.

Installation should be performed by a qualified network technician or licensed low-voltage professional familiar with Ethernet demarcation equipment. Power down or disconnect the network segment before terminating copper or inserting SFP modules. Follow applicable TIA/EIA cabling standards and local network infrastructure codes during installation. Do not force SFP modules into slots; verify module compatibility with the device before seating.
